Overview
The MC74HC540AN is an octal inverting buffer, line driver, and line receiver manufactured by onsemi. It utilizes high-performance silicon-gate CMOS technology and features a 20-pin DIP package. The device operates within a supply voltage range of 2.0 V to 6.0 V. Key electrical parameters include a maximum propagation delay of 80 ns at 2.0 V and 15 ns at 6.0 V. Output drive capability supports up to 15 LSTTL loads, with low input current of 1 µA.
Feature Summary
- Octal inverting buffer/line driver/line receiver design
- Outputs directly interface to CMOS, NMOS, and TTL logic families
- Two ANDed active-low output enables for bus-oriented systems
- High noise immunity characteristic of CMOS devices
Applications
- 3-state memory address drivers
- Clock drivers
- Bus-oriented systems

Selection Notes
Select this component for applications requiring octal buffering with inverted outputs. Compare against HC541A if non-inverting functionality is needed. Verify that the 2.0 V to 6.0 V operating range meets system power constraints. Consider the 15 LSTTL load drive capability for interfacing requirements.
Part Context
This part belongs to the HC540A series of octal buffers. It is functionally similar to the LS540 but offers CMOS low power dissipation. The device is pin-compatible with other standard logic families, facilitating direct replacement in existing designs without layout changes.
